Butter Saute of Spring Potatoes and Green Peas
- 4 medium New potatoes
- 30 grams Green peas
- 40 to 50 grams Butter
- 200 ml Water
- 1/4 tsp Salt
- 1 Pepper
- Peel the potatoes and cut in half.
- Soak in water to get rid of bitterness.
- Boil the green peas in salted water and remove while they are still hard.
- When they come floating to the surface, they're good.
- Put the potatoes in a pan.
- Add water and 30 g of butter, and start cooking over high heat.
- When it comes to a boil, turn down the heat to low.
- Add salt and cover with a lid, and simmer for about 10 minutes, or until the potatoes are cooked through.
- When the potatoes are cooked, add the green peas and the remaining 10-20 g of butter, and simmer for 2 to 3 minutes.
- Add grindings of pepper to finish.
- Even though this is only flavored with butter, it's delicious, and you can drink up the cooking liquid too.
- (Although it's rather high in calories.)
